Preparation Steps
- Rinse the long-grain basmati rice under cool water until clear, then soak in ½ cup of water for 30 minutes.
- After soaking, drain the rice and transfer it to a blender with 2-3 tablespoons of water. Blend until a coarse paste forms and set aside.
- Melt 1 teaspoon of ghee in a heavy-bottom pan over medium heat.
- Pour in 1.5 liters of whole milk when ghee is hot, stirring often to prevent scorching.
- Once boiling, reduce heat to low to simmer gently for a creamy texture.
- Stir in the ground rice paste, 3 tablespoons of Thandai powder, and the saffron milk. Cook on low heat for 35-40 minutes until thickened.
- Remove from heat when you achieve a desired creamy consistency.
- Chill in terracotta pots or bowls for 3-4 hours.
- Garnish with slivers of almonds, pistachios, and dried rose petals before serving.
